Transaction 566277498e560dbe5052820ac6404428959164f308480662146c86274d9c4dd5
1 Input
1 Output
-
566277498e560dbe5052820ac6404428959164f308480662146c86274d9c4dd5:0
- value
- 69378284
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8859b41be12c7a5ee5d5740fc6daef5a5785af8bbbd87c0da238d27bd7904d26
- address
- bc1p3pvmgxlp93a9aew4ws8udkh0tftcttuth0v8crdz8rf8h4usf5nqn95aaq